k**m 发帖数: 222 | 1 #include
using namespace std;
int main(void)
{
queue q1;
queue q2;
queue q3;
return 0;
} |
h***s 发帖数: 19 | 2 queue has problem
【在 k**m 的大作中提到】 : #include : using namespace std; : int main(void) : { : queue q1; : queue q2; : queue q3; : return 0; : }
|
k**m 发帖数: 222 | 3 why? thanks.
【在 h***s 的大作中提到】 : queue has problem
|
h***s 发帖数: 19 | 4 /usr/include/c++/3.2.3/bits/stl_deque.h:676: forming reference to reference
/usr/include/c++/3.2.3/bits/stl_deque.h:676:: Too many arguments
【在 k**m 的大作中提到】 : why? thanks.
|
c****y 发帖数: 24 | 5 reference has to be initialized
【在 k**m 的大作中提到】 : #include : using namespace std; : int main(void) : { : queue q1; : queue q2; : queue q3; : return 0; : }
|
h***s 发帖数: 19 | 6
【在 c****y 的大作中提到】 : reference has to be initialized
|
t****t 发帖数: 6806 | 7 STL container 就没打算让你用container of reference.
【在 k**m 的大作中提到】 : why? thanks.
|
G*O 发帖数: 706 | 8 reference不是变量,必须声明的时候定义
比如
int a;
int & b = a;
int & c; // error!
【在 k**m 的大作中提到】 : #include : using namespace std; : int main(void) : { : queue q1; : queue q2; : queue q3; : return 0; : }
|